Hi Peter,
I recently looked at some system hang issues. While at it, I tried to use
and understand lockdep. These patches are made as a result. I believe they
should have helped me, so hopefully they do for others as well.
Many thanks to Bart, Joe, and Peter for their valuable comments.
Change from v2:
- Removed indent adjustments only patch
- Removed unnecessary if to else-if patch
- Made changes according to comments
- Added another doc addition patch
Change from v1:
- Rebased the patch series.
- Added more no-functional-change patches.
- Removed zapped locks in lock chains printing patch, which was a band-aid.
The real problem was recently fixed by Bart.
